#4f450f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4f450f is composed of 31% red, 27.1%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 12.7% magenta, 81% yellow and 69% black. It has a hue angle of 50.6 degrees, a saturation of 68.1% and a lightness of 18.4%. #4f450f color hex could be obtained by blending #9e8a1e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

● #4f450f color description : Very dark yellow [Olive tone].
#4f450f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4f450f has RGB values of R:79, G:69, B:15 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.13, Y:0.81, K:0.69. Its decimal value is 5195023.

Shades and Tints of #4f450f
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0b02 is the darkest color, while #fefefc is the lightest one.

Tones of #4f450f
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#32312c is the less saturated color, while #5d4f01 is the most saturated one.
